Barrell Ridge Trail Details
A short side trail from the Middle Fowler Trail, it ascends steeply to the open summit with wide views of the northern area of the park. From the South Branch Pond Campground it is a 6.6 round mile rewarding day hike.
Difficulty
Moderate
Distance
.3 miles
Estimated time
1 hour
